Montas was only 16 pitches into his start when he was struck by a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.baseball-reference.com\/players\/w\/wardta01.shtml?utm_medium=linker&amp;utm_source=lastwordonsports.com&amp;utm_campaign=2024-04-22_br\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Taylor Ward<\/a> line drive below his right elbow and was still able to throw out Ward at first base. However, he left the mound after the team trainer examined his arm. X-rays revealed no fractures, but now Montas will be placed on the 15-day injured list with right forearm contusion. He has a 4.19 ERA over 19 1\/2 innings for the Reds this season. There was concern that it could have been a serious injury for Montas. He had missed most of the 2023 season due to a right should injury that needed surgery.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;I couldn&#8217;t feel my hand. It swelled up right away. It just really hurt at the time,&#8221; Montas said. &#8220;Anytime you get hit in the arm, especially your pitching arm, you&#8217;re a little concerned. A lot of thoughts go through your head.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>After his depature,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.baseball-reference.com\/players\/s\/suterbr01.shtml?utm_medium=linker&amp;utm_source=lastwordonsports.com&amp;utm_campaign=2024-04-22_br\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Brent Suter<\/a> picked up Montas with 3 1\/3 innings of strong work for the series sweep. It was Suter&#8217;s second-longest relief outing of his career, allowing four singles and a walk with no runs allowed.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;Obivously your hear is with Frankie taking one right off his favorite arm there, which is a bummer. How showed flashes of quality by posting a 3.13 ERA over 161 innings for Oakland during the 2018-19 sesasons. Unfortunately, part of his 2019 season was cut short due to an <a href=\"https:\/\/lastwordonsports.com\/baseball\/2019\/06\/21\/frankie-montas-suspended-80-games\/\" target=\"_self\">80-game PED suspension<\/a>. After finishing sixth in the American League Cy Young Award voting in 2021, the right-hander pitched well in 2022. The Oakland Athletics <a href=\"https:\/\/lastwordonsports.com\/baseball\/2022\/08\/01\/frankie-montas-traded-to-the-new-york-yankees\/\" target=\"_self\">moved Montas<\/a> to the New York Yankees as part of a six-player trade. Things didn&#8217;t go well for Montas in the Bronx, who struggled to a 6.35 ERA over eight starts and 39 2\/3 innings.
